yeah its the longest running bug, its just annoying you can fix it by just pressing ctrl alt c 2 times more and then opening urlbar
or just not going to compact mode while urlbar is open and then opening it
this bug is caused because when you apply backdrop filter to sidebar, it forces the sidebar to a composting layer which messes the position of urlbar since i guess the urlbar position depends on sidebar

its intentional, when the background behind sidebar is transparent, the sidebar will not be transparent to avoid readblity issues
because otherwise things like this can happen, where text of website below the sidebar can leak through it
so nebula applies a background layer to it
the blur for sidebar works when there is a solid background website
well i didn't know it was intentional and thought it was a bug. would it better if it was transparent with some blurring ability?
understandable in this case
there's been a lot of threads created with users trying to achieve the transparency with blur effect for the compact sidebar, which they also thought it was supposed to be like this.
do you believe there is a way to still achieve this, even to have the option to tweak it to your liking?
yeah but it cant be transparent with blurring when website is itself transparent, its a css limitation soo..
the thing is when the background is transparent, we cant apply blur directly so we need some sort of layer
thats why i added the background so that it applies blur
like this
the background is visible and blurs the page below it
